Chicago L Train Takeover
ON AN OTHERWISE-NORMAL TUESDAY AFTERNOON, designer Livy Hoskins and I were called into an office and told business in Chicago needed a boost. To do that, we were going to fill the L train with ads. It was the biggest offline campaign we’d ever attempted, and it needed to be done by Friday morning. No time for a photo shoot. No time for a lot of back-and-forth. We dropped everything and got to work. With the guidance of the art director, Charlie Gann, and the head of branding, Kyle Miller, this campaign increased awareness by 125 percent.
